Bloomfield is a village in Walworth County, Wisconsin, United States. The village was created on December 20, 2011, from unincorporated areas of the Town of Bloomfield. It includes all of the Pell Lake census-designated place and part of the Powers Lake census-designated place.

Walworth County is a county located in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. As of the 2020 census, the population was 106,478. Its county seat is Elkhorn. The county was created in 1836 from Wisconsin Territory and organized in 1839. It is named for Reuben H. Walworth.
